The ‘Medical Cannabis for Pain Control’ course available on Coursera offers a comprehensive overview of the multifaceted role that cannabis plays in modern medicine. Covering essential topics from the history of medical cannabis to its pharmacological interactions and safety considerations, this course is a valuable resource for healthcare professionals, researchers, and anyone interested in the medical applications of cannabis.
The course begins with an introduction to pain and the historical context of cannabis use, providing learners with a solid foundation. It then delves into the botanic aspects of cannabis, exploring its biological characteristics. The core of the course examines how cannabis interacts with the human body, its effectiveness in managing pain, and its potential to treat other medical conditions.
A significant focus is placed on safety, addressing potential risks and safety measures, which is crucial given the ongoing debates surrounding medical cannabis. The course’s structure, with clear lessons and engaging content, makes complex topics accessible and digestible.
